configure multiple SSL VPN endpoint

I'd like to configure an UTM that has multiple ISP uplinks to enable SSL VPN access to all of the external interfaces , for fault tolerance purpose .

Is that possible ? Looking at the configuration seems impossible since it accepts only one external interface .

    In the Server settings under Remote Access > SSL > Setting, if you select Any (which is also the default value), Sophos UTM will allow SSL VPN connections on all Interfaces. Since SSL VPN client will attempt to connect on all Interfaces, it will also work when one of your WAN interfaces goes down.
